Functional interaction between the nervous and endocrine systems plays a crucial role in sodium and water balance regulation, steroid production, glucose metabolism, and thyroid function. The crosstalk between the brain and the endocrine system is particularly evident in various forms of brain injury, including traumatic brain injury, hemorrhage, or tumors. This chapter describes different forms of brain–endocrine crosstalk, with special focus on the clinical implications of this interaction in perioperative medicine and neurocritical care.
